New paintings, from the series "Divine particles", are based on my experience as a bone marrow donor for my sister. After successful surgery, I became fascinated by the nano world and genetic images, with the focus on the idea of DNA.

In my work, double helix has become a symbol of life and of constant movement. In the search for the beauty of the particles, hidden from the human eye, I was inspired by the idea of forms rather then the scientific truth. As a fine artist, I am aware, that visual world is governed by it’s own visual laws.

My professional degree and training is rooted in the classical European traditions; and I am influenced by the ancient culture of my birth place - Georgia, where I graduated from Tbilisi Academy of Fine Arts. I believe my background gave me a variety of tools to create my own visual language.
For the past 20 years, I’ve been living in the United States and working mostly as a figurative artist. Here, I was able to explore, travel and grow further as an artist and a human being.
Although I have shown in the US and in Europe, and my work is on display in public and private collections in many parts of the World, this is my first public exhibit in Washington, D.C., as I only moved here few months ago.
